A list of 20 probable players who might be on the Indian team for the upcoming T20 World Cup in the Caribbean and USA was reportedly revealed recently. Two very interesting names in Virat Kohli and Yuzvendra Chahal were included in the list. 

While there were talks of Kohli unlikely to be picked, Chahal was out of the Indian team for a long time now. However, his consistent bowling in this edition of the IPL so far has impressed the selectors. Kohli is topping the Orange Cap list with 361 runs from seven games while Chahal topping the Purple Cap list with 12 wickets from seven games as well. 

In Shubman Gill and Yashasvi Jaiswal, the Indian squad has two youngsters who have displayed immense potential for the team in recent times. Last season, Gill finished on top of the Orange Cap list with 890 runs in 17 matches. Meanwhile, Jaiswal smacked 625 runs in 14 games, with a ton and five half-centuries.

Now experts Eoin Morgan and Zaheer Khan have shared their opinions on the squad that has been revealed for the upcoming T20 World Cup squad. Morgan had his favor towards Gill but said that the slot for the other opener will be between him and Yashasvi Jaiswal and that Kohli's spot is guaranteed in the XI. 

For Me Virat Kohli Is Already There: Zaheer Khan

"Shubman Gill's a magnificent player and highly regarded, not just here, but around the world, for me has to be a contender to be on the plane, let alone get in that strongest XI and when it comes to contending for batting positions, in that six or seven batters that they might take given the all around us that they have, it does come up to probably him or Yashasvi Jaiswal. And not a case of him against Virat Kohli. For me, Virat Kohli is there already," Morgan said.

Zaheer Khan, on the other hand, said that he is finding it difficult to choose between the two openers. 

"Well, selectors are definitely gonna have some good headaches there, because when you're looking at the top order of of any team, there is a lot of traffic jam there. You know which direction selectors are going to go and we have to wait and see. But if you ask me, Shubman has to be there, and it will be between Yashasvi and Shubman for sure. Maybe they will stick to Virat being at number three. They've already announced Rohit as captain. So you you know that there is only one spot up for grabs" added Zaheer Khan. 

Gill and Jaiswal both have had slow starts in this edition of the IPL. Gill has scored 262 runs in the first seven games so far at an average of 43.83. His team was skittled out for just 89 by Delhi Capitals at the Narendra Modi Stadium on Wednesday. Jaiswal surprisingly has not got a start yet in this year's IPL with just 212 runs from seven games at an average of 17.29.
